Coin Detail
Click here to see enlarged image.
ID:     11326
Type:     Byzantine
Region:     BYZANTINE EMPIRE
Issuer:     Constantine V, Copronymus
Date Ruled:     AD 741-751
Metal:     Bronze
Denomination:     Follis
Struck / Cast:     struck
Date Struck:     AD 741-751
Diameter:     20 mm
Weight:     2.379 g
Die Axis:     6 h
Obverse Legend:     ΛE/W/N (on right)
Obverse Description:     Constantine V and Leo IV, each stand facing wearing crown and chlamys and holding akakia, cross between heads
Reverse Legend:     Λ/E/O/N - ∆/E/C/Π
Reverse Description:     Leo III, bearded, standing facing wearing crown and chlamys, cross potent in right
Mint:     Syracuse
Primary Reference:     SBCV 1569
Reference2:     DOC 19
